Local Business Built On Bacon Is Smokin'!

PITTSBURGH (NewsRadio 1020 KDKA) - Opportunity comes in lots of ways.

For Jared Lordon and Kelly Patton, both cooks on a local and national scale, it came in an old wood shed on the North Side.

"What they were doing previously there was roasting whole lambs, chickens and pigs for ethnic celebrations," says Lordon.

He and his partner saw the rotisseries and smoking equipment, and got the idea to make smoked meats like bacon, kielbasa, chicken, pork loins and more, and do it high-quality local ingredients. Now, their meats are ending up in restaurants and kitchens across the region.

KDKA-AM's Larry Richert and John Shumway talk to Jared Lordon about how he and his partner are building a business that is bringing home the bacon with their off the wall idea.

"I'm the guy that has crazy schemes and ideas," says Lordon. "This might be my last one."
